Mealybug Biology and Identification Characteristics
As you explore the world of mealybugs, it’s important to understand their biology and how to recognize them in your garden or indoor plants.
These tiny pests use waxy coatings as both protection and camouflage, part of their mealybug adaptation strategies that help them survive on plants. The longtailed mealybug exhibits a unique reproductive behavior where females retain their eggs until they hatch, which distinguishes them from other species egg retention.
Covered in waxy filaments, mealybugs blend in seamlessly—almost as well as they blend into our gardens unnoticed until damage appears.
Female mealybugs lay hundreds of eggs in cottony sacs, while males—though winged—are mostly seen only briefly before dying.
Identifying them starts with looking for the distinct white filaments covering adults and nymphs, which vary by species.
Mealybug feeding habits focus on plant sap, often hiding in leaf folds or root areas.
Young crawlers move actively to find food sources, while older stages stay sedentary.
Understanding these biological traits helps gardeners spot mealybugs early and take action before populations grow.

Wilting and Yellowing
While mealybugs may be small, their impact on plants can be quite significant—especially when it comes to wilting and yellowing. These pests pierce plant tissues to feed on sap, causing nutrient deficiency that disrupts essential processes. This feeding activity not only weakens the plant’s ability to photosynthesize but also makes it more susceptible to diseases (plant vulnerability).
Physical symptoms include drooping leaves, stems losing rigidity, and new growth showing particular vulnerability. Yellowing (chlorosis) appears as mealybugs extract chlorophyll-rich sap, weakening photosynthesis.
Wilting often begins in tender areas mealybugs target first. Indoor plants may show sudden changes when outbreaks go unnoticed until damage is visible. Early intervention is key to prevent wilting from progressing to withering and structural collapse in severe cases.

Ant Attraction Risks
Though ants may seem like harmless garden visitors, they often arrive uninvited through mealybug infestations, creating a dangerous partnership for plants.
Ant behavior is driven by the sugary honeydew mealybugs excrete, which ants farm for food while protecting their hosts from predators. This mutualism alters ecological interactions, as ants spread mealybugs between plants, accelerating infestations.
Visible damage includes yellowing leaves, wilting stems, and sooty mold from honeydew deposits. Severe cases cause stunted growth, flower loss, and plant death.
Ants also shield mealybugs, making control challenging.
Monitor for ants near plants—hidden mealybug colonies may exist. Address both pests together using targeted treatments.

Common Plant Targets
Mealybugs target specific plants that offer them easy access to sap and shelter, making identification essential for control.
Understanding common plant targets helps gardeners anticipate and manage these pests effectively. Host plant preferences vary by species—citrus mealybugs favor soft-stemmed plants like fuchsia and jade, while root mealybugs attack African violets and palms.
Mealybugs often settle in stem tips and leaf axils where sap flows freely. Recognizing which plants are most at risk lets you act early. For instance, hibiscus hosts pink hibiscus mealybugs, and cacti invite citrus mealybugs.
Knowing these patterns empowers you to protect your collection wisely.
Habitat Clues to Locate
Whether you’re dealing with a hidden infestation or simply building your identification skills, recognizing habitat clues helps you locate mealybugs before they cause visible damage.
Mealybug behavior reveals preferences for specific plant structures—seek soft stems, succulents, or bark crevices.
- Inspect soil for waxy rings around roots in potted plants like African violets.
- Check leaf axils and stem tips where mealybugs congregate in dense foliage.
- Look beneath bark on cypress or juniper for specialized habitat clues.
Observe how environmental factors influence their location choices, from greenhouse warmth to high-humidity areas.

Mealybug Species Diversity and Host Specificity
Though often mistaken for simple dirt, mealybugs reveal fascinating diversity that goes far beyond their cottony appearance. Belonging to the Hemiptera order, these scale insects showcase remarkable species interaction patterns, with genera like Planococcus and Phenacoccus inhabiting everything from maples to citrus trees.
Their ecological roles shift based on host specificity—some specialize on succulents, while others thrive on ornamental plants or agricultural crops. Morphological differences between sexes and wax secretion variations further distinguish these pests, whose distribution impacts local ecosystems.
Understanding this diversity helps gardeners target treatments effectively, whether dealing with maple-specific Phenacoccus aceris or widespread Planococcus citri.
Life Cycle, Reproduction, and Population Dynamics

While their cottony appearance might suggest otherwise, these tiny pests have complex life cycles that shape their impact on gardens.
Mealybugs begin as eggs in protective sacs, hatch into crawlers that disperse, and develop through multiple nymphal stages before reaching adulthood. Their ability to reproduce rapidly creates generational overlap, making control challenging.
- Females lay 100-600 eggs in cottony sacs, with some species retaining eggs until hatching.
- Nymphs go through 3-4 instars before becoming adults, moving to feed and build waxy coverings.
- Warm temperatures accelerate development, allowing up to six generations per year indoors.
Understanding these stages helps gardeners predict outbreaks and target treatments effectively.
Integrated Management and Treatment Strategies
Understanding mealybug life cycles helps us plan effective treatments, but managing these pests really requires a thorough approach that combines several strategies working together.
Integrated strategies blend chemical treatment, biological control, cultural methods, mechanical techniques, and pest monitoring for best results.
Combining chemical, biological, cultural, mechanical, and monitoring approaches delivers the best mealybug control.
Start with sanitation practices—clean plants and tools regularly to cut habitats. Use targeted insecticides on larvae and pupae, rotating formulas to manage resistance.
Introduce natural predators like ladybugs or Cryptolaemus beetles alongside fungal sprays. For small outbreaks, swab mealybugs with alcohol or blast them with water.
Keep an eye on populations with regular checks, adjusting methods as needed. How Do Mealybugs Affect Plant Root Systems?
Mealybugs pierce roots with their mouthparts to suck sap, disrupting nutrient transport and weakening the root system.
This damage to phloem impairs water absorption, causing stunted growth and yellowing leaves.
As mealybug populations grow, plants show declining health through wilting and collapse.
Regular soil inspections are essential to catch root mealybugs early before they cause irreversible harm to your plant’s foundation.
Are There Pesticides Specific to Mealybug Species?
Yes, there are pesticides specific to mealybug species—you can find options like Carbaryl for raspberry mealybugs or Chlorpyrifos for persimmon and banana pests.
However, mealybugs’ waxy coverings often reduce pesticide effectiveness, especially on mature stages.
Organic alternatives like neem oil or horticultural soaps offer safer treatment methods.
Do Mealybugs Have Other Natural Predators Besides Wasps?
Yes, they do! Organic predators like ladybugs, lacewing larvae, and minute pirate bugs all feast on mealybugs.
These beneficial insects help control populations naturally. Ladybugs devour mealybugs along with aphids and other pests.
Lacewings prey on a variety of soft-bodied insects too. And pirate bugs also target mealybugs when hungry.
You can encourage these natural predators by avoiding harsh chemicals and providing habitats.
They work best as part of a broader integrated pest management strategy that includes mealybug parasites like wasps.
How Do Mealybugs Spread Between Plants Naturally?
Mealybug movement starts when tiny crawlers, the first-stage nymphs, crawl from one plant to another.
Plant proximity matters – close-growing plants make it easy for these mobile pests to disperse.
Crawlers can also fall from pots through drainage holes or be carried by wind.
Keep susceptible plants separated and inspect regularly to slow their spread.
